Louisiana Employment-Based Immigrant Visa Categories in Harahan
Harahan employment-based immigrant visa petitions — categorized under the EB-1, EB-2, and EB-3 visas — are made to allow experienced workers across the globe to contribute to the American economy. Each category has its own set of criteria that are tailored to various qualifications and skill sets.
Immigration Lawyers for EB-1 Green Cards in Harahan, LA
EB-1 is reserved for those with extraordinary abilities in their field, multinational managers or executives, and outstanding professors or researchers. This highly selective category requires individuals to have achieved significant contributions to their industry of field of expertise. They are not required to get a labor certification.

Petition for an EB-2 Green Card with Louisiana Immigration Attorneys
EB-2 green cards are designed specifically for people with advanced degrees or exceptional abilities in the sciences, arts, or business. Applicants under this category must satisfy stringent requirements and they often need employer sponsorship. The employer must be able to sponsor the individual and demonstrate that there are not any U.S. applicants available for the role. However, some qualified applicants may also qualify for a National Interest Waiver (NIW), bypassing the need for sponsorship from an employer.

Secure an EB-3 Employment-Based Immigrant Visa with Harahan, LA Immigration Attorneys
The EB-3 immigrant visa is for experienced employees and professional workers, and other workers with less specialized education or skills than what’s required of EB-1 and EB-2 applicants. An EB-3 green card accommodates a wider range of individuals, from maintenance workers and healthcare aids to construction workers. However, these individuals must already have a certified labor certification.
